Convergent Boundary

Directions of Plate Movement:

The plates move towards each other and collide.

Major Geological
Earthquakes, volcanoes, mountains

Divergent Boundary

Directions of Plate Movement:
The plates pull apart from each other.

Major Geological Events:
Trenches, valleys

Transform Boundary

Directions of Plate Movement:
The plates slide past each other.

Major Geological Events:
Earthquakes, valleys, trenches
